About HyperPhysics
- Overview: A comprehensive, interconnected physics and astrophysics instructional repository created in 1998 by Dr. Carl Rod Nave at Georgia State University.
- Structure: Designed as an "exploration environment" using concept maps and small, interconnected "cards" (reminiscent of HyperCard and neural networks) to facilitate non-linear learning.
- Interactive Features: Includes Javascript-enabled calculations and active formulas to allow users to perform numerical explorations and "What if" scenarios.
- Usage Statistics: Historically reached approximately 50 million file hits per year (estimated 3 million users annually); recent data indicates roughly 2 million file accesses per day.
- Global Reach: Distributed to 86 countries; translations are underway or licensed in German, Italian, Chinese, and Spanish.
- Licensing and Copyright:
- Copyrighted by Dr. C.R. Nave; it is not freeware or shareware.
- Unauthorized mirroring or copying is prohibited.
- The project is independent, refusing commercial advertisements to maintain educational integrity.
- Distribution:
- Available for free individual use on the web.
- Full content is available on USB memory for $50 to support site maintenance and development.
- The author is open to proposals for non-profit instructional use and collaborative translation projects.
- Recognition: Selected by the National Science Teachers Association (NSTA) SciLinks program.
